Elden Ring Guide | Black Steel Greathammer Build

Black Steel Greathammer is one of the most intriguing weapons from the Elden Ring: Shadow of the Erdtree DLC.
The Black Steel Greathammer offers a unique approach to combat that centers around maximizing guard counter damage through strategic equipment choices and tactical play.
Weapon Overview
The Black Steel Greathammer utilizes the standard Greathammer moveset, providing excellent Hyper Armor for trading blows with opponents in Elden Ring.
You'll find several roll catch setups available, with the light attack flowing into heavy attack being the most reliable combo. However, the weapon's standout feature lies in its powerful guard counter mechanic.

When you block an attack and immediately follow with a heavy attack, you trigger a guard counter that chains into an area-of-effect attack after landing the initial hit.
This unique property makes the weapon particularly effective when you build around enhancing guard counter damage in Elden Ring.
Primary Talisman
You'll want to equip the Curved Sword Talisman as your foundation piece, since it directly enhances your guard counterattacks. This Talisman becomes essential for maximizing the weapon's primary strength.
Deflecting Hardtear Integration
Think about adding the Deflecting Hardtear to your arrangement. This tear not only goes well with your guard counter concentration, but it also gives you more damage after you successfully deflect.
The damage boost builds up over time. Deflecting one opponent within five seconds gives you extra damage, and deflecting a second opponent increases this to 40%. If you deflect four opponents in a row, the added damage is capped at 80% in Elden Ring.
Faith-Strength Hybrid
There are several ways to set up the attributes for this construct. A pure strength concentration is still possible, but the faith-strength mix offers numerous benefits.

The Sacred Blade Ash of War applies a holy damage buff to your weapon, which synergizes well with the Black Steel Greathammer's existing holy damage split in Elden Ring.
Additional Enhancement Options
You could add the Holy-Shrouding Cracked Tear to your Physick mix. This gives your attacks a lot more damage because your weapon does a lot of holy damage.
Talisman Configuration That Works Best
Your Talisman setup should prioritize maximizing damage while also allowing for adaptability to various situations.
The Shard of Alexander makes your Sacred Blade Ash of War stronger, which you'll use a lot to keep your attack rating high. The Curved Sword Talisman is still required to improve guard counters in Elden Ring.
The Two-Handed Sword Talisman provides additional value since you'll be two-handing the weapon consistently, and the weapon's already high attack rating makes the percentage increase particularly worthwhile.
Finally, the Bull-Goat's Talisman ensures you maintain sufficient poise to avoid interruption from light weapon follow-up attacks, allowing you to execute your guard counters without fear of being stunned mid-animation.

Combat Strategy
Your primary approach involves positioning yourself to bait enemy attacks, successfully blocking or deflecting them, then immediately responding with guard counters in Elden Ring.
The weapon's area-of-effect follow-up makes it particularly effective in group encounters or when facing opponents who rely on close-range pressure.
Maintain your Sacred Blade buff throughout encounters to keep your attack rating maximized.
The holy damage enhancement works exceptionally well when combined with the weapon's natural holy damage scaling, creating substantial damage output on successful guard counters in Elden Ring.
